Torrid, a prominent women’s clothing brand based in California, has had to make the difficult decision to shutter over 150 of its stores across the country, marking another challenging chapter for physical retail outlets.

The brand, which is well-known for catering to plus-size women with sizes ranging from 10 to 30, closed 151 stores deemed “structurally unproductive” last year. This includes 77 locations that were shut down during the fourth quarter, as outlined in their recently released year-end report to shareholders.

The report did not specify the number of stores in California that are affected by these closures.

Founded in 2001 in the City of Industry, located in eastern Los Angeles, Torrid began its journey with a single store in the Brea Mall. Since then, it has grown into a nationwide brand, according to KTLA.

By early 2026, Torrid was operating 483 stores spanning all 50 states, as well as Puerto Rico and Canada.

Despite these closures, Torrid’s CEO, Lisa Harper, expressed a positive outlook in the shareholder report, stating, “We enter 2026 with a strong operational foundation – optimized channels, product, and pricing.”

“This positions us to accelerate customer fille growth through renewed marketing efforts, helping us re-engage past shoppers, attract new customers and deepen loyalty across our existing base. I am confident we are on the right path and encouraged by early signs of progress we are seeing in the business.”

Last year proved a brutal one for many longtime retail staples.

Forever 21 and Rue21 shut down all of it remaining locations, while Claire’s, Carter’s, American Eagle Outfitters, Victoria’s Secret and Foot Locker closed dozens more.
